QUESTION YOUR WORLD - Leap Day Science!



What's going on in February this year? Why is the month of March one whole day further back than I'm used to??

Well, for the answer to that we'll have to turn to our old friend, Math!

The Earth's orbit around the sun is 365 days, kinda. Though we count it as 365 in reality each year yields a little extra time. The actual time it takes the Earth to orbit the sun is 365.25 days a year (yielding a surplus quarter of a day at the end of the year). So, the Gregorian calendar, the one we use, came up with a very simple but effective solution...everytime we hit the 4th quarter day (every 4 years) we add a 'Leap Day'! 4 quarter days = 1 full day, right?

There's some other pretty amazing math that goes into Leap Day too!

For example:
Years that are divisible by 100 can NOT be leap years, however years divisible by 400 CAN be leap years...So, 2100, 2200, 2300 will not be leap years, however 2400 and 2800 will be leap years!

Also, in the span of 2 millennia we will only have a total of 485 leap years! Which makes this year pretty special.

QUESTION YOUR WORLD - How long is a light year?



So, how long is a light year...short answer: Long!!! long answer: about 5.9 trillion miles!!! That's how quickly light can traverse across space. So if you wanted to walk the distance of a light year you would need to be marching on your feet for about 168 million years!! For you to arrive at this moment, you would have had to start walking from the time when dinosaurs ruled the earth! Whew...better pack a few lunches for the calories you would have been using up! The speed at which light travels is still the fastest known speed in our universe.

QUESTION YOUR WORLD - COFFEE!!!!!



Did you have any coffee today? A lot of people did. The United States moves about 400 million cups of coffee every day! Everything from intricate gourmet coffee to the basic cup of plain coffee. Even the basic cup of coffee is still very complex, holding over 1500 chemicals! The most familiar is caffeine, of course. It takes caffeine about 30 minutes to be fully absorbed by our body. Once in the bloodstream, it actually does enhance thought process and the body's capacity for physical activity.

Also, coffee contains antioxidants. Actually, Americans get more antioxidants from cofee than any other food or beverage!

Several studies have suggested that coffee may even reduce the risk of various diseases such as type 2 diabetes, Parkinson's, and Alzheimer's!

QUESTION YOUR WORLD: What's auto racing ever done for my life?

Racecar Inventions by ScienceMuseumofVA

In the early days of auto racing a second person was used as a spotter to look for other vehicles and check the gauges. All that changed when Ray Houron won the inaugural Indy 500 in great part to his stunning new invention, the rear view mirror. This eleminated the weight of the extra person and began a tradition that is still used to this day.

Also, in 1922 Barney Oldfield installed a major safety device in his car, the seat belt. About a quarter century later the factories in Detroit took notice and started to instal them their vehicles.

Fuel additives, tire technology, disc brakes? Yep, you guessed it! All invented to make race cars run smoother and safer. Thanks to these speed hungry technichians many of these inventions can be found in your driveway!!

QUESTION YOUR WORLD: How many people live on Earth?

Population 7 Billion! - Question Your World by ScienceMuseumofVA

There's a pretty good chance that you've seen some other people today somewhere. Well, we are currently ushering in a new milestone for humanity, 7 billion people. That's right, the Earth is home to 7 billion of us. This is most impressive considering that it took us nearly 199,000 years to get from very few of us to 1 billion of us. 1804 marked the year when humanity reached the billions. The thought of 1 billion people in 1804 is pretty interesting, but pails in comparison to the exponential growth that our population saw soon after. Check out how we grew from 1 billion to 7 billion:
1804 - After nearly 200,000 years we reached 1 billion
1930 - 2 billion
1960 - 3 billion!
1974 - 4 Billion!!
1987 - 5 BILLION!!!
1999 - 6 BILLION!!!!!!
2011 - 7 BILLION!!!!!!!!!!

So nearly 199,000 years to get to 1 billion and only 207 years to get to 7 billion! That's some exceptional exponential growth!

A picture is worth a thousand words

SMV is conducting a multi-year study of fishes and invertebrates. Yes, we’re collecting, identifying, and counting critters! But we’re also looking at the physical environment: water temperature, current, pH... all sorts of other factors that determine what critters live where.

OK, this is where I need to get a bit “wordy” to explain things. You see, one goal of this study is designing a mathematical model… basically, a computer program… that can predict what critters should be in a creek. Plug in your values for stream order, stream depth, etc etc… and wow, here’s a list of the fishes and inverts you’ll find!

Believe it or not, scientists get really excited about this type of modeling. A program like this could then predict how climate and ecosystem changes will play out in the future. In the midst of an epic drought? Tweak the input values for water temp and stream depth, and see what happens to your fish populations.

Of course, to build a realistic program, we need to look at data from more than one stream (we’re studying 21.) And we definitely need to consider how human factors (Storm runoff! Culverts! and dams!
